                                               JOB INTERVIEW
When you apply for a job, one of the most important things is job interview. In order to make a good impression
during a job interview, you need to prepare yourself for the interview carefully.
Punctuation is very necessary. You should arrive in plenty of time so that you have a little of time to relax and
keep calm before the interview.
       You should be well dressed. Do not wear a skirt which is too short or jeans. You also need to plan what
you are going to say. You have to answer a lot of questions about your education and experience. You may be
asked many things about yourself, and especially about the reason why you decide to apply for the job.
       You can ask the interviewer about the salary you expect, the position you are applying and the duties you
have to do in the job.You also must try to find out as much as possible about the company you want to work for.

     In many modern countries, people think about a family as a mother, a father and their children. But this is
not the only kind of the family group. In some parts of the world, a family group has many other members. This
kind of large family is called an “(46) ______ family” or a “joint family”
     The joint family includes all living relatives on either the mother’s or the father’s side of the family. It is
made up of grandparents , parents ,brothers, sisters, uncles, aunts and cousins . They live together in a large
house or in huts (47) _____ close together .
     Early people probably lived in joint families. They had to be part of a large group in order to survive. The
members of the group help each other hunt. They work together to protect (48) ________ from dangerous
animals and other enemies. In China, people lived in joint families. When a son married, he and his wife lived at
his parents’ house. (49)______ daughters remained at home until they married. Chinese children felt very loyal
(50) ______ their parents. Younger members of the joint family always took care of the old ones.
